Phoros

Archimandrite Nikifor’s Biblical Encyclopedia

—the name represented by Parosh in the parallel Hebrew lists. (1) (1 Esdras 5:9) an ancestral head whose descendants returned with Zerubbabel (Ezra 2:3; Neh. 7:8). (2) (1 Esdras 8:30) the family designation of Zechariah, who returned with Ezra (Ezra 8:3). (3) (1 Esdras 9:26) a family whose members were among those who had married foreign women (Ezra 10:25).
